- Baseline Socioeconomic Reports: The Bureau of Land Management, Cheyenne, Wyoming, intends to award on a sole source basis with University of Wyoming. This is a project that has an overarching goal of evaluating different approaches that can be used to develop socioeconomic baseline reports. Therefore, this project will take two approaches to producing socioeconomic baseline reports within two different social and economic contexts in order to provide information on the benefits and challenges of the different approaches as well as provide socioeconomic baseline reports for use by FO and DO personnel. Each approach used in this project is considered a pilot study which will result in two baseline socioeconomic reports, one for each pilot study. These pilot studies will produce baseline reports of specified social and economic variables for a larger scale (District Office (DO) level) stable planning area as well as a smaller scale (Field Office (FO) level) expected boom planning area. One pilot studys (WY) approach will focus on the identification and collection of local data while also highlighting where local data may not exist or is not of a quality suitable for use by the BLM. The other pilot study (AZ) will be comprehensive in order to provide value to larger scale EISs, while also provide guidance about what data may be most applicable to certain types of routine EAs where a full description of the social and economic environment is not necessary. The approach to this baseline study (AZ) is focused on utilizing easily obtained data from two different programs accessible to the public on the internet No solicitation package will be available.
